My First Day at Work....

So I started my new job today and it is completely different than Utah. First off dental assistants aren't allowed to ANYTHING here! It's kinda sweet, cause I get paid quite a bit more to do less? Funny how that works out. But here we're not allowed to prophy, which is clean kids teeth. And they don't wanna pay a hygienist everyday to come, so the dentist actually does it and I have to "assist" them while they do it. So I pretty much just stand there with suction and wait for the spit to spatter! YUM! And the office is tiny!! I really fell like I'm stepping on people's toes all the time! Cam would go crazy here, with his O.C.D.-ness with stuff on the counters, because there is stuff EVERYWHERE!!! In the floor on the bathroom, the O2/N2O Tanks are in the waiting room, there is no staff lounge, its just a mini fridge and microwave in the back of reception, (and that is about the same space as Tonya's Office is at the Redwood Office I work at in Utah.)
